All eladrin have that +5 vs Charm. I don't have my books or the CB handy, but a quick search turned up a thread at the Wizards forum.
Indeed! All Eladrin have +1 Will and +5 vs. Charm as a racial attribute. See p. 285 of Heroes of the Fallen Lands. This applies to the initial save vs. the effect, but not the later DC10 roll to end the effect once the first save is failed. Isn't that correct, Scotley?

Depends. There is no "initial save." The DC10 roll is the save. The "initial save" is when the power rolls versus a defense to attack you.

I'm fuzzy on the Eladrin bonus applying to defenses or to saves though. But if it applies to saves, then it would mean they only need to roll 5 or better to successfully save against Charm effects, unless the effect in question had some save penalties on it.

Umm, why are we not reading the line from the PH p. 38:

"In addition, you [Eladrin] gain a +5 racial bonus to saving throws against charm effects."

Seems pretty clear to me to a 5+ saving throw roll against a charm effect is successful in ending the charm effect. So in this case??, the effect steps down for a round and the next savings throw??
